‘Ballo’ Portable Stereo Speakers by Bernhard Burkard for OYO


"Bernhard Burkard is a swiss design studio, developed the ‘Ballo Speaker’ speaker for Hong Kong based brand OYO (Objects You Obsess).
The shape of the Ballo is conceived as a perfect sphere with no actual stand. The speaker is round as a ball and lays, rolls or hangs for a 360 degree music experience. A colorful belt fuses two hemispheres, protecting the speaker and increasing the bass tones when placed on a surface. The device is equipped with a built-in rechargeable lithium battery. A standard 3.5mm jack used for headphones makes the Ballo compatible with most audio devices. The speaker turns on automatically when connected to a device. If you want stereo sound you need to connect 2 speakers via a stereo wire, as the audio output is singularly mono.

Nosaj Thing – Saturn’s Return


"Underground producer Nosaj Thing dabbles in various genres, having worked with everyone from Kendrick Lamar to Toro Y Moi over the span of his decade-long music career. The Los Angeles-based artist is working on a new album, Home, which is a follow-up to his 2009 genre-blurring release, Drift. The artist sat down with HYPETRAK for an exclusive interview about his love for hip-hop, working with designer Daito Manabe and the roller coaster that is being in one’s 20s. An altogether humanizing interview for a lofty talent, the conversation surely generates attention for Home, which releases on January 22. Choice excerpts from the interview can be read below while the interview is available in its entirety here.



Let’s talk about early beginnings, how did you get started with music?

I got into DJ’ing through older friends when I was 12, but I started producing freshman year of high school. I was 13 and a friend of mine gave me some production software and I installed it on my Dad’s computer and since then I was just kind of hooked.

What was the music like in the beginning?

The guys that I was DJ’ing with, they were doing hip-hop so it started with that. But then my homie that gave me the production software also liked house music. So it was cool that I had friends that were into different types of music at a young age that influenced me to actually try different styles from the start.

Speaking of style, your sound it’s very unique, is that something you can put into words?

Ha, I don’t know, man. Well for Nosaj Thing it’s hip-hop, it’s electronic music. It’s experimental." - Hypebeast

Cash Kings 2012 – Hip-Hop’s 20 Top Earners


"Forbes is back with its Cash Kings 2012 list, naming the Top 20 earners of the Hip Hop industry for the year. There are not too many surprises on the list. Dre tops it with the incredible sum of 110 Million USD, followed by Diddy with 45 Million USD. Jay-Z and Kanye West sit on spots 3 and 4 of the list, not surprising with their ‘Watch The Throne’ tour activities of the last 12 months. The top earners did not make their money with music though – Dre made 100 Million USD with his Beats By Dr. Dre headphone empire, which was sold in part to HTC and Diddy once again made a fair share of his money with Ciroc Vodka.
See the full Top 20 earners of the Hip Hop industry in 2012 here below.
1. Dr. Dre: $110 million
2. Diddy: $45 million
3. Jay-Z: $38 million
4. Kanye West: $35 million
5. Lil Wayne: $27 million
6 Drake: $20.5 million
7. Birdman: $20 million
8. Nicki Mianj: $15.5 million
9. Eminem: $15 million
10. Ludacris: $12 million
11. Pitbull: $9.5 million
12. Rick Ross: $9 million (tie)
13. Wiz Khalifa: $9 million (tie)
14. Snoop Dogg: $8 million
15. 50 Cent: $7.5 million
16. Swizz Beatz: $7 million (tie)
17. Pharrell: $7 million (tie)
18. Young Jeezy: $7 million (tie)
19. Mac Miller: $6.5 million (tie)
20. Akon: $6 million" - High Snobiety

Case of Bass – Boombox Made of Recycled Vintage Suitcase

Clever naming, combination of technology and vintage luggage, and you have Case of Base...


"Brothers Ezra and Alex Cimino-Hurt have built a business around the adage “One man’s trash is another man’s treasure.” Their Portland-based company, Case of Base, repurposes old and discarded luggage to create portable sound systems with classic audio components, powered by lightweight Li-on battery packs. The pieces are categorized into four distinct classes — Courier, Debonair, Diplomat and Swarthy — depending on the case size and speaker capacity. They can also be built to customers’ specifications, including input types, amplifier size, power supply and batteries.
